Smart Network Selection and Packet Loss Improvement during Handover in Heterogeneous Environment
2013
BEST PAPER AWARD; International audience; Seamless Handover between networks in heterogeneous environment is essential to guarantee end-to-end QoS for mobile users. A key requirement is the ability to select the next best network. Currently, the implementation of the IEEE 802.21 standard by National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) considers only the signal strength as a parameter to determine the best network. In this paper, we propose including additional parameters such as available bandwidth, mobile node speed and type of network during selecting a new network to improve the QoS for mobile user's application. Le mobilier archéologique de l’habitat du Hallstatt final à Écuelles « Charmoy » (Seine-et-Marne)
2005
The Ecuelles Charmoy site is one of the first Late Hallstatt settlements to be discovered on the edge of the plateau that dominates the Seine-Yonne confluence. In use for only a short period at the end of the 5th and during the first half of the 4th century BC, the site includes postholed buildings, storage pits and other structures in an organized domestic space. The pottery, especially the painted ware, is particularly abundant in the storage pits and constitutes a reference of local ware and its production. La fosse 264 du Néolithique récent de Vignely « La Noue Fénard » (Seine-et-Marne)
2014
A pit dating to the Recent Neolithic was discovered at Vignely, la Noue-Fenard during work on a Middle Neolithicenclosure that backed on to an ancient bank of the river Marne. The cylindrical structure, the primary function of which has not yetbeen determined, was used as a refuse pit and contained a particularly rich collection of finds, notably wild animal bones, stoneobjects, bone tools, grinding tools and pottery. The study of the finds has revealed activities directly relating to game hunting,exploiting animal resources for meat, bone, fur, … The objects show marked regional affinities with the collective tomb of Vignely,la Porte-aux-Bergers and the Isles-lès-Meldeuses ensemble.
